ECOSYSTEM APPROACH TO DETERMINATION OF LOSSES FROM POLLUTION OF WATER RESOURCES WITH REGARD TO THE FORMALIZATION OF THEIR VALUABLE MEASUREMENTS
Abstract: The theoretical and methodological principles of ecosystem assessment of losses from pollution of water resources are researched. For the first time scientific approaches to ecosystem assessment of losses from water pollution by objects of losses, which include three main aspects: orientation to the development of the theory of losses of ecosystem services, the theory of ecological risk and the theory of degradation of the water ecosystem, are grounded. The algorithm and conceptual scheme of ecosystem estimation of losses from pollution of water resources which can be applied at formalization of their value measure is offered.
Key words: ecosystem approach, damage from pollution, cost measurement, water resources.
